Default dell inspiron wi fi issues

this is probably a simple fix but head is firmly up backside at the moment with other issues

I have a dell inspiron 6000 with built in wireless here. My brother has been using it at his for sometime and connecting to sky broadband via a Netgear DG834G wireless router that they provided. He managed to knock the router off the shelf damaging it and the laptop couldnt pick up wireless.

Sky sent out a new one but in the meantime he was connecting via a wired connection. Since getting the new one he has been trying to get the wireless setup but to no avail.

I have since been round to his and cant get it sorted either, it seems to suggest its connected as windows reports excellent strength and 54MBPS. However on opening internet explorer it cannot display any pages. Almost as if the computer is connected to router but router not to internet.


So I have brought it back here to try and connect to mine but it still has the same problem. It says its connected to my router but I cannot access the internet on the laptop. I know the router is connected to the internet fine as im posting via my computer now using the same wireless connection.


Any ideas what the issue could be?

on a side note the latop is unable to access the router settings by putting in the ip address of 192.168.0.1

It seems to suggest that although it is saying its connected to the router its not quite there

I'd start off by conecting to the router via ethernet using DHCP (start - control panel - network connection. right click ethernet icon - properties. under "this connection uses the following settings:" select 'TCP/IP' and click properties this should tell you if you're using DHCP. It should say "obtain IP address automatically" Check this (this may solve your problem) but check by going to command prompt and type ipconfig, This will tell you the IP adress of your router. enter this IP address into IE and see if it connects. If this doesn't work post back.

thought it might be something simple, it was set to obtain a specific ip so i changed it to automatic and all is well now
